Hungarian goulash
Ingredients/Components
- salt - 2 tsp
- flour - 2 Tbsp
- brown sugar - 1 Tbsp
- water
- shortening - 1/4 c
- dry mustard - 1/2 tsp
- paprika - 2 tsp
- Worcestershire sauce - 2 Tbsp
- catsup - 3/4 c
- small clove garlic, minced - 1 item
- sliced onion - 1 c
- hot cooked noodles - 3 c
- dash of cayenne red pepper - 1 item
- beef chuck or round, cut into 1-inch cubes - 2 lb
How to make hungarian goulash:
Melt shortening in a large skillet. Add beef, onion and garlic. Cook and stir until meat is brown and onion is tender. Stir in catsup, Worcestershire sauce, sugar, salt, paprika, mustard, cayenne and 1 1/2 cups water. Cover and simmer 2 or 2 1/2 hours. Blend flour and 1/4 cup water. Stir gradually into meat mixture.
